Mary Hernandez 1933 - 1998

Mary H Hernandez of San Antonio, Bexar County, TX was born on May 5, 1933, and died at age 65 years old on November 18, 1998. Mary Hernandez was buried at Ft. Sam Houston National Cemetery Section 12 Site 626 1520 Harry Wurzbach Road, in San Antonio.

In 1933, in the year that Mary Hernandez was born, on March 4th, Franklin Delano Roosevelt became the 32nd President of the United States. He was elected four times (equaled by no other President) and guided the United States through the Great Depression, the Dust Bowl, and World War 2. His wife was his cousin Eleanor Roosevelt (Teddy Roosevelt's niece) who President Truman called "First Lady of the World". Some of the major programs that survive from his presidency are the Securities and Exchange Commission, the Wagner Act (The National Labor Relations Act of 1935) , the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ation and Social Security.

In 1961, Mary was 28 years old when on April 17th, about 1,000 CIA trained Cuban exiles invaded Cuba with the intention of igniting a rebellion and overthrowing Castro. They were defeated within three days. Although the operation began under Eisenhower, Kennedy approved it and the operation, named the Bay of Pigs for the beach where they landed, was a humiliation for the United States.
